Output 3956afc4d8aa879d76819ef6680b1f0c7e04fc86cef5d34819d6704bca01ebdf:2

value
92463103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ad1dc685f4e94b0d4a720980010ea33d32140a OP_EQUAL
address
M9y4Uywen4dDchVtP4C8vkF1dT2REhqVw4
transaction
3956afc4d8aa879d76819ef6680b1f0c7e04fc86cef5d34819d6704bca01ebdf
spent
true